Welcome to the rotation. Feewright is the rules engine that computes shipping fees for all Bramblehook storefronts. Rules are authored by ops staff via a DSL; inputs are untrusted, so treat every rule evaluation path as attack surface. Known risks: regex-based rules can cause CPU exhaustion, and rule imports bypass normal review. Never hot-patch rules in prod without a second approver. Escalations go to the Pricing Integrity channel. The threat model, sandbox limits, and audit procedures are documented on the internal page below.

operations page: https://jenkins.zemvarcloud.local/job/merge_requests/repo/build/73930b4b30f0a8ed

## Onboarding: Canary Gate Rules

Canary deploys at Pellwright are gated by three checks: error-rate delta under 0.5%, p95 latency within 10% of baseline, and zero failed health probes over ten minutes. Gate evaluations are recorded in the `canary_verdicts` table for audit. To inspect past verdicts during onboarding exercises, connect to the deploy metadata database using the string below.

primary connection of yagep-kahip = redis://giliel_svc:zYiKsLL2PLpfPL@db-348f.xolmarsys.corp:5432/fenwyn

14:22 — Priya noticed the nightly fleet fuel-usage report from Haulgrid was showing zeros for every truck in the Westmere depot. Turned out the aggregator job had quietly restarted mid-run and skipped a partition. We reran it manually and numbers looked sane again. For anyone digging into this later, the bad run came from the build tagged below.

session token of tajef-bageg = htk21_5d90d574934f3ccae6437

## Build Provenance — Admin Dashboard Dark Mode

Dark-mode support for the Ombrelle admin dashboard ships from the themed-assets pipeline, not the main bundle. Token values for the dark palette are generated at build time from the shared design manifest, so reviewers should diff the manifest rather than the compiled CSS. Any dark-mode change without a matching manifest commit should be rejected. Each themed build is signed by the pipeline, and its provenance token is recorded directly below.

build token for yawep-yawig: htk14_7f638ddd9dd645